Overview
The 9FGL08P1A000KILFT is an eight-output PCIe clock generator from Renesas Electronics, designed for high-performance computing and server applications. It supports PCIe Gen 1 through Gen 6 architectures, including Common Clocked (CC), Separate Reference no Spread (SRNS), and Separate Reference Independent Spread (SRIS). The device operates at a nominal 3.3V supply voltage with a range of 3.135V to 3.465V. It features integrated terminations for both 100Ω and 85Ω systems, reducing external component count. The unit is housed in a compact 48-lead VFQFPN package and functions within a temperature range of -40°C to +85°C.
Feature Summary
- Supports PCIe Gen 1–6 CC, SRNS, and SRIS clocking architectures
- Eight differential LP-HCSL outputs with dedicated OE# pins for CLKREQ# functionality
- Integrated output terminations for 100Ω and 85Ω systems
- Pin-selectable spread spectrum: SRNS 0%, CC 0%, and CC/SRIS -0.5%
- SMBus-selectable CC/SRIS -0.25% spread spectrum

Procurement Notes
Verify the specific suffix 'A000' against official Renesas documentation to confirm pinout and configuration settings, as suffixes often denote factory-programmed SMBus defaults or specific hardware strapping options. Ensure the 48-VFQFPN package dimensions align with PCB layout requirements. Confirm moisture sensitivity level (MSL) handling procedures during assembly.
Selection Notes
Select this component when designing PCIe Gen 1–6 interfaces requiring eight synchronized clock outputs. It is suitable for systems needing integrated termination resistors to save board space. Consider the 9FGL0851D variant if only six outputs are required or if different spread spectrum configurations are preferred. Verify input frequency compatibility (typically 25MHz or 100MHz crystal/LVCMOS) before integration.
Part Context
This part belongs to the 9FGL08xx series of PCIe clock generators. It shares architectural similarities with the 9FGL0241/51 and 9FGL0441/51 devices but provides eight outputs instead of two or four. It is part of Renesas' broader portfolio of low-power clock solutions for data communication and storage applications.
Replacement Considerations
Direct substitutes include other members of the 9FGL08xx family, such as the 9FGL0851D, provided the output count and electrical specifications match the design requirements. Cross-referencing with the 9FGL0831CKILF is possible for legacy PCIe Gen 1–3 designs, though voltage levels and feature sets differ.
